How they compare

Paraguay currently reports 23.34 % change on previous year against 5.46 % change on previous year in WB: Early-demographic Dividend, a difference of 17.88 % change on previous year.

That makes Paraguay's figure about 4.3 times WB: Early-demographic Dividend's.

The two have swapped places 24 times across 40 shared years of data; in 1971 it was Paraguay ahead.

Paraguay ranks 37th and WB: Early-demographic Dividend ranks 34th of 182 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Paraguay averaged higher in 4 and WB: Early-demographic Dividend in 2.
